A True Understanding of Climate Change

There’s a lot of climate change news out there, and it can be hard to know what to believe. To get a true understanding of climate change, it’s important to look at the science behind it. Climate change is caused by things like burning fossil fuels, deforestation, and industrial agriculture. These activities release greenhouse gases into the atmosphere, which trap heat and cause the Earth’s temperature to rise. This can lead to a number of effects, like more extreme weather events, melting glaciers, rising sea levels, and ecosystem changes. Understanding these causes and effects is important for knowing how to best protect our planet from further damage.

The Difference Between Weather and Climate

When most people think of climate change, they think of the weather. But what’s the difference between weather and climate? Weather is what’s happening right now outside your window. Climate is made up of patterns of weather over time. Climate change happens when those patterns are disrupted.

What Is Global Warming?

You may have heard about climate change, global warming, or greenhouse gases in the news, but what do those terms really mean? Climate change refers to a broad array of environmental degradation that is predicted to result from increasing levels of atmospheric CO2, including global warming, alterations in precipitation, sea level changes, and more extreme weather events. Climate change effects include both public health impacts, like the increased spread of disease, and physical impacts, like droughts and floods. Climate change causes include human activities like burning fossil fuels and deforestation.

How Our Actions Impact the Environment (This section has 4 sub-sections)

Our actions have a significant impact on the environment. Burning fossil fuels releases greenhouse gases into the atmosphere, which causes climate change. Climate change effects include more extreme weather events, such as hurricanes, floods, and droughts. These events can damage infrastructure, displace people, and cause loss of life. Climate change also causes ocean acidification, which is detrimental to marine life. To prevent further damage to our planet, it is important to understand both climate change’s causes and effects.

Climate change effects

  •  Rising sea levels. One of the most well-known effects of climate change is rising sea levels. This is caused by two main factors melting ice and thermal expansion. The effects of rising sea levels are far-reaching and can include increased flooding, erosion, and salination of soil.
  •  Extreme weather events. Climate change can cause more extreme weather events, like hurricanes, tornadoes, and blizzards. These events can damage homes, disrupt transportation, and cause power outages.
  • Droughts and water shortages. Climate change can lead to droughts and water shortages in certain areas as a result of changes in precipitation patterns. This can have a devastating effect on crops, leading to food shortages.

Rising Sea Levels

If you live near a coast, one of the most immediately obvious effects of climate change is rising sea levels. As water temperatures warm, ice sheets and glaciers melt, and seawater expands, the global sea level has risen about 8 inches since 1880. The rate of sea level rise is accelerating, and by 2100 it could be as high as 2 feet. That may not sound like much, but even a small rise in sea level can increase the risk of flooding during storms. And as our oceans continue to warm, we can expect even more sea level rise in the future.

Water Shortage

One of the major effects of climate change is water shortages. As the earth gets warmer, evaporation increases, leaving less water for plants, animals, and humans. This is especially true in areas that are already drought-prone. With less water available, competition for resources increases, and conflict over water can erupt. In addition to affecting our ability to grow food and sustain life, water shortages also lead to economic losses as businesses are forced to close or scale back operations. If we don’t take action to address climate change, we’ll only see more extreme weather events and devastating consequences like water shortages in the years to come.
